Lots of retirees are going back to work
May 5, 2022
About 1.5 million retired people have reentered the workforce, according to an analysis of Labor Department data by an economist at Indeed. Many retirees are returning as wages grow, concerns about the novel coronavirus pandemic fade and cost of food and fuel increase.
